ALBANY — The New York State Public Service Commission (Commission) today confirmed granting the construction and operation of a battery-based energy storage facility with a capacity of up to 100 megawatts (MW) located in Astoria, Queens. The $132 million facility will be built by East River ESS. . NYCIDA closed its. . The 150 MW Andasol solar power station is a commercial parabolic trough solar thermal power plant, located in Spain. The Andasol plant uses tanks of molten salt to store captured solar energy so that it can continue generating electricity when the sun is not shining.

How can a battery management system prevent a fire?
Using battery management systems (BMS), predictive analytics, and strict quality standards can minimize fire hazards and ensure safe, reliable energy storage. Battery fires in energy storage systems can cause severe infrastructure damage, toxic gas emissions, and rapid fire spread, making early detection and suppression critical.

Are there fires at grid-scale energy storage facilities?
"Historically speaking, there have been very few fires at grid-scale energy storage facilities," Roberts said. The ACP report includes an assessment of incidents by the Fire and Risk Alliance, an engineering and consulting company, that looked into 35 fire incidents at U.S. battery systems between 2012 and 2024.
